The Dreams of the Last Drum

“Dreams of the Last Drum” narrates a collective dream to repair the territories damaged by modernity. The film follows the walk of a spirit of ancestral resistance that moves through different planes of space-time. It takes place in a Patagonian forest, a spiritual landscape where there is no beginning or end, only a multispecies walk for life. We can see how the boundaries between dream and reality blur, creating a threshold, where states overlap. We witness the energetic attempts of a group of girls to connect with the hidden messages of the earth, of a dying ecosystem trying to regenerate itself. Communication takes place through electric hyphae, vibratory waves, generative sounds and ancestral chants that arrive through dreams (pewmas) to help them balance the world, to decompose the contaminated systems left behind by modernity, while they welcome new forms of life. When their physical bodies rest, their “pvji / pvllv” (spirits) begin to walk.

Van Der Kritz | AR

Van der Kritz is an art collective based in Buenos Aires, Argentina, formed by Alejandra Van der Land & Matías Kritz. Through speculative end-of-the-world fiction, which they call “situated energy fiction” (Sit-En-FI), they develop visual and sound practices to investigate contaminated and relational ecologies. They use the scientific and extractivist universes of modernity as contexts in which to sow local ancestral knowledge. They create an energetic language where there is no beginning or end, nor up or down, only a multispecies spiral for life in which multiple worlds coexist. It can be seen how the boundaries between nature and technology, between dream and reality, between life and death, become blurred, creating a threshold where states overlap.
